[0084] Examples and Comparative Examples
[0085] As shown in Table 1 below, multilayer electronic components (MLCCs) were fabricated while changing each composition, particle size, and content. Ultra-high capacity MLCCs (with a dielectric thickness of 0.5 μm or less and an internal electrode of 0.3 μm).
[0086] In addition, the capacitance and reliability of the fabricated ultra-high capacitance MLCCs were measured with breakdown voltage (BDV) accelerated lifetime, and the results are shown in Table 1 below.
